What is Halotestin?
Halotestin, also known by its chemical name Fluoxymesterone, is a prescription-only AAS originally developed in the 1950s. It was primarily used to treat hypogonadism, delayed puberty, and certain types of breast cancer in women. Due to its powerful androgenic effects, Halotestin quickly caught the attention of athletes and bodybuilders seeking to enhance their performance.

Myth: Halotestin is Safe to Use
Despite its potential benefits, Halotestin poses noteworthy risks and side effects. Like all AAS, Halotestin can negatively impact cardiovascular health by altering cholesterol levels, increasing blood pressure, and contributing to the progression of heart disease. Additionally, Halotestin can suppress natural testosterone production, leading to hormonal imbalances, testicular atrophy, and potential fertility issues. It is crucial to prioritize safety when considering the use of Halotestin or any other AAS and to consult with a medical professional.
Reality: Halotestin Poses Risks
Halotestin’s potential risks should not be taken lightly. Apart from cardiovascular and hormonal concerns, its use can also lead to liver toxicity, as the substance is orally administered and passes through the liver. Consequently, liver function should be regularly monitored if Halotestin is used. Furthermore, Halotestin may exacerbate aggression and irritability, leading to behavioral changes commonly referred to as “roid rage.” These psychological effects can negatively impact relationships and overall well-being.
